How they compare
Marshall Islands currently reports 0.7273 constant LCU per US$ of GDP against 0.7146 constant LCU per US$ of GDP in Germany, a difference of 0.0127 constant LCU per US$ of GDP.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 56 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Germany ahead.
Germany ranks 185th and Marshall Islands ranks 182nd of 212 countries.
Marshall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
GDP (constant L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
